Year of the Dragon and Blackout Shift at Bandito’s Burrito Lounge

Sunday, April 19

With a bit of funk, metal and punk, the band Year of the Dragon is Los Angeles to the core of its user-friendly being. Founding member “Dirty” Walter A. Kibby II helped popularize the recipe with L.A. ska-punk funksters Fishbone in the ’80s. Year of the Dragon is more late-period Bad Brains and Living Color in its hyperactivity than Fishbone, but born of the same uplift mofo party plan that made the Red Hot Chili Peppers bankable commodities. The group brings its colorblind afterparties at ground-zero sound to Bandito’s Burrito Lounge on Sunday, April 19. Local hard rockers Blackout Shift open. Doors open at 9 p.m. Free. banditosburritolounge.com.
